On your mark: Pizza dough.

Get set:
a.3 cups of flour
b.1 teaspoon salt
c.one package of yeast
d. 1 teaspoon honey
e. 1 Tablespoon olive oil
f.1 cup warm water (from the tap is fine)

Go: Combine dry ingredients in a bowl (I use a food processor). Combine wet ingredients. Press on button to mix dry ingredients and slowly add wet to dry as processor is running. Leave it on for a few minutes. Dump the dough on a cutting board, knead in enough flour to keep it from being sticky. Cut in half. One half the dough will make a pizza large enough for two people.

Freeze the other half for another day. I do three batches because why get the bowl dirty for only one batch? I wrap the dough in plastic wrap in a neat package. When I take it out to thaw I unwrap, put the dough in a greased bowl and put the wrap on top. The rest is in a million recipe books.
